Realme UI 3.0 ‘Early Access Roadmap’ Q2 2022

Before going into the merits of the models listed and the timing reported for each of them, it is essential to make a premise: as can also be read in the official image below, the roadmap refers only to building early access, while for stable ones the wait will be longer and no reference times are reported; secondly, the roadmap is aimed at the Indian market only. That said, let’s get straight to the point.

Realme has shared directly on its official forum the roadmap of updates to the Realme UI 3.0 Early Access based on Android 12 for Q2 2022. The models listed include, among others, Realme 8 5G, Realme 9 5G and Realme 9i. Here are all the details:

April 2022

  • Realme 8 5G
  • Realme 8s 5G
  • RealmeNarzo 30 5G

May 2022

  • Realme X7 5G
  • Realme 9i

June 2022

  • Realme X3
  • Realme X3 SuperZoom
  • Realme Narzo 30 Pro 5G
  • Realme 9 5G.

The manufacturer specifies that all the models listed will receive their early access build by the end of the corresponding month, while for stable releases it will be discussed at a later time.

All the news of the Realme UI 3.0 based on Android 12

The update to the Realme UI 3.0 based on Android 12 brings with it numerous innovations for the smartphones of the Chinese house. The major update, in fact, intervenes on various aspects, such as design, functionality, customization tools and privacy available to users.

Among the most important innovations, the renewed design undoubtedly stands out. In this regard, the manufacturer talks about a more organized layout and a smoother overall UI experience. The design of the icons has also been restyled, which becomes more three-dimensional, and a wider range of colors is added than the previous version 2.0. There is also no shortage of new customization possibilities, starting from the fact that with the Realme 3.0 it is possible not only to customize the global theme of the smartphone, but also to adapt the AOD to your preferences.

Speaking of fluidity, a requirement that strongly affects the quality and pleasantness of the user experience, there is the new AI Smooth engine that brings improvements in this aspect, while reducing energy consumption. In numerical terms, the Asian manufacturer quantifies such improvements in overall app launch performance that is 10% faster and in a 12% improved battery life. All this without neglecting a promised reduction of 30% of memory usage with an increase in its speed of use.

The major update to Android 12 has devoted a lot of attention to the profile of privacy and user data management and the Realme UI 3.0, which is based on this release, is not far behind. New features made available to users include, for example, the ability to delete photo location information and photo data, including the timestamp, camera model, and settings to safely share photos and videos with your smartphone. Adding to the whole also new limitations on the use of permissions by apps.
